How does publishing a Rise 360 course to SCORM work with storyline blocks and videos?

How does publishing a Rise 360 coursework with storyline blocks linked to Review 360 and videos to SCORM work? Does a published SCORM package also include those storyline files? Are these automatically embedded or are there things I can check to make sure they are embedded and included in the final SCORM package? I want to be sure that the final SCORM package doesn't have "holes" where these blocks and videos should be. thank you!!

  • All blocks are treated equally during publishing and are included. No holes; no post-publishing edits to the scorm package required.

  • I'll add some details to what Owen and Karl said. 

    When you publish a Rise course with a Storyline (SL) block, the published files include all the files needed to display the SL block in the course.

    The "Storyline files" in the published output do not include the .story file that was used to create the content for the SL block.

    If you need to edit the content in the SL block, you'll have to edit the .story file in Storyline, publish the update to Review 360, reinsert that into the SL block, and then republish the Rise course.
